PACE'S 11 HITS NOT ENOUGH AS SETTERS FALL TO BENTLEY 5-2
WALTHAM, MA - The Pace baseball team pounded out 11 hits on the day but fell 5-2 to the Falcons of Bentley College in Northeast-10 Conference action. The Setters fall to 19-11 overall and 9-2 in the NE-10, while the Falcons improve to 11-19 and 6-9 in conference play.
Pace would get on the board in the opening inning as Andre Liscinsky (Trumbull, CT/Trumbull) led off with a single and moved to third on a throwing error. Liscinsky would score as the Falcons turned a double play for the first run of the game.
The Falcons would rally in their half of the third, pushing across a pair of runs to take a 2-1 lead. The Setters responded in the fourth with a two-out rally. Aaron Zrenda (Niantic, CT/Chaffee Loomis Prep) singled down the right field line and scored the tying run on a double by Matt Rigoli (Parsippany, NJ/Parsippany).
Bentley would take the lead back in the seventh innings, loading the bases with two outs. Ross Curley (Lexington, MA) would triple to left field scoring all three runners, giving Bentley a 5-2 lead that the Setters could not overcome.
On the hill for Pace, Michael Mastrogiovanni (Glen Rock, NJ/Glen Rock) started, tossing five innings, allowing five hits and two earned runs, while striking out five. Dane Doucette (Middletown, NY/Middletown) pitched one innings allowing one run on two hits and struck out one. Michael Franza (Lynbrook, NY/Lynbrook) (0-2) went one inning, giving up two run on one hit, while Eric Brown (Norwalk, CT/Norwalk) tossed a scoreless inning.
